The Impact of Deforestation
Deforestation has widespread effects that affect ecosystems, the climate, and species diversity. When forests are cleared for farming, city expansion, or wood extraction, the loss of trees disrupts the delicate harmony of the ecological balance. Trees play a critical role in capturing carbon, absorbing CO2 from the atmosphere. Without them, the carbon that was stored in forest biomass is returned back into the air, contributing greatly to greenhouse gas emissions and the climate crisis.
In addition, the clearing of forests leads to the destruction of habitats for countless species of vegetation and animals. Many types of living organisms rely on forests for nutrients, habitation, and places to breed. As their habitats disappear, species richness declines, leading to the loss of species that are not suited to changed habitats. This reduction of biodiversity weakens ecosystem strength, making it harder for nature to bounce back from environmental stresses and disturbances.
In addition, deforestation influences both local and global water cycles. Forests play a crucial role in maintaining the hydrological cycle by facilitating groundwater recharge and providing moisture into the environment through transpiration. The removal of woodland can lead to alterations in rainfall patterns, increased loss of soil and reduced clean water availability. Utilizing Sustainable Power
Renewable power resources, such as solar, wind, and hydro energy, offer viable answers to tackle environmental change while fostering eco-friendliness. By utilizing these sources, societies can decrease their reliance on non-renewable fuels, thereby decreasing GHG emissions and mitigating the impacts of deforestation. The transition towards renewables not only enhances environmental well-being but also enhances energy security and robustness against environmental challenges.
Investing in renewable energy framework stimulates local financial development and employment opportunities. As new technologies arise and develop, they offer opportunities for advancement and development. The shift to a renewable energy economy demands trained labor, promoting educational initiatives and workforce training that equip workers with the essential abilities. As communities accept this shift, they become more self-sufficient and less susceptible to the volatility of international energy markets.
Additionally, the integration of renewable energy into current systems allows for increased flexibility in the face of environmental challenges. Smart grids and energy holding solutions enable effective energy management, optimizing the use of renewable energy based on accessibility and need. By constructing a strong energy infrastructure that can endure the effects of environmental change, we pave the way for a viable future where nature’s resilience is mirrored in our energy choices.
